| Obverse description | Detailed relief view of the Befreiungshalle rotunda near Kelheim, shown in three-quarter perspective with its colonnade, statuary figures, and stepped podium. A curved legend arcs around the upper field, with the Roman date MDCCCLXIII inscribed in the lower exergue. |

| Reverse description | A six-line dedicatory inscription in Fraktur blackletter script occupies the central field, enclosed within a rope-bordered inner circle. A finely detailed laurel wreath tied with a ribbon at the base surrounds the inner circle, filling the outer field. |
